Headshot of Sara Pepper

Sara Pepper

Director of Creative Cardiff

Sara’s role is to provide leadership and strategic direction for the creative economy project and team at Cardiff University. It is her ambition to inspire, encourage and support working relationships across the city through networking, partnership engagement and knowledge exchange which will in turn enable Creative Cardiff to achieve its aims.

Sara is the Chief Operating Officer of Clwstwr - one of nine Creative Industries Clusters across the UK, funded by the UK Government Industrial Strategy - which aims to put innovation and R&D at the core of media production in South Wales. She is responsible for the daily operation and execution of Clwstwr’s ambitions and plans. She works with a wide variety of stakeholders including academic, industry and government partners.

Sara is passionate about championing and developing new talent and ideas and brokering partnerships that enable individuals and organisations to realise their full creative and commercial potential.

Previously Sara has held a wide variety of posts from producer to project manager for organisations such as the Southbank Centre, the BBC, the Wales Millennium Centre, Hull University School of Arts & New Media and the Sydney Olympic Games 2000. Sara is currently a member of BBC National Orchestra and Chorus of Wales Advisory Group and the National Trust Wales Advisory Board.
